Subject: bug#22050: fuse.ko not automatically loaded on GuixSD
Date: Sun, 29 Nov 2015 12:36:05 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<87io4lm40q.fsf@gnu.org> (raw)

On GuixSD, fuse.ko is not automatically loaded when someone tries to
access /dev/fuse:

--8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8---
$ sshfs SOMEHOST /tmp/x
fuse: device not found, try 'modprobe fuse' first
--8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8---

We do have FUSE’s udev rules installed by default, but they don’t seem
to do much:

--8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8---
50-udev-default.rules:75:KERNEL=="fuse", MODE="0666", OPTIONS+="static_node=fuse"
99-fuse.rules:1:KERNEL=="fuse", MODE="0666"
--8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8---
